The cheapest way to get from Dumaguete to Metro Manila (State) is to drive and ferry which costs ₱2,700 - ₱11,000 and takes 24h 42m.
The fastest way to get from Dumaguete to Metro Manila (State) is to fly which takes 2h 11m and costs ₱5,000 - ₱9,000.
No, there is no direct ferry from Dumaguete to Metro Manila (State). However, there are services departing from Dumaguete and arriving at Manila North Harbor Pier 4 via Tagbilaran Port.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 29h 14m.
The distance between Dumaguete and Metro Manila (State) is 666 km.
The best way to get from Dumaguete to Metro Manila (State) without a car is to bus and taxi and bus and ferry which takes 20h 15m and costs ₱4,400 - ₱5,500.
It takes approximately 2h 11m to get from Dumaguete to Metro Manila (State), including transfers.

What companies run services between Dumaguete, Philippines and Metro Manila (State), Philippines?
Cebu Pacific and Philippine Airlines fly from Dumaguete–Sibulan Airport (DGT) to Ninoy Aquino International Airport (MNL) every 3 hours. Alternatively, you can take a ferry from Dumaguete to Quezon City via Tagbilaran Port and Manila North Harbor Pier 4 in around 29h 14m.
